What Is the Heber Valley Railroad?

The Heber Valley Railroad—affectionately known as the “Heber Creeper”—runs classic steam locomotives through scenic Heber Valley. It’s beloved by locals and visitors alike for fun, relaxing excursions with nostalgic flair.

Heber Valley Railroad at a Glance

Detail What to Know
Nickname “Heber Creeper”
Trains Classic steam locomotives
Typical duration Most excursions last less than two hours
Popular themes Chocolate Lovers Train, Rock n’ Roll Train, Chinese New Year Train
Approximate cost $20 per person

Tip: Themed rides are popular. Book early during weekends and holidays.

FAQs About the Heber Valley Railroad (Quick Answers)

How much does the Heber Valley Railroad cost?

Approximate cost: $20 per person.

How long are the rides on the Heber Valley Railroad?

Most excursions last less than two hours.

What is the “Heber Creeper”?

It’s the affectionate nickname for the Heber Valley Railroad, which runs classic steam locomotives around the valley.

Are there themed trains for families?

Yes. Popular themes include the Chocolate Lovers Train, Rock n’ Roll Train, and the Chinese New Year Train.
